Skip to main content
Partner Stories

Dynamics 365 Data Integration: Best Practices to Ensure Clean, Consistent Data

Why Data Integration Matters in Dynamics 365?

In the modern enterprise, data is the currency of decision-making. Yet, having scattered, inconsistent, or outdated data can derail productivity, create reporting errors, and lead to costly business mistakes. This is where Dynamics 365 data integration comes in.

By integrating data from multiple sources—ERP systems, CRM platforms, marketing tools, and third-party applications—Microsoft Dynamics 365 becomes the single source of truth for your business. When done correctly, data integration ensures clean, consistent, and accessible information for every team across the organization.

In this article, we’ll walk through best practices for Microsoft Dynamics 365 data integration, share tips to maintain clean data in Dynamics 365, and show you how to avoid the pitfalls of poor data quality.

What Is Dynamics 365 Data Integration?

Dynamics 365 data integration is the process of connecting Microsoft Dynamics 365 with other applications and databases to unify information in one place. It enables businesses to:

  • Combine ERP and CRM data for a 360° view of customers.
  • Streamline processes between sales, marketing, finance, and operations.
  • Maintain consistent data in Dynamics 365 across all departments.

For example, you might integrate Dynamics 365 CRM and ERP to sync sales orders, customer records, and financial transactions, eliminating manual data entry and reducing errors.

The Risks of Poor Data Integration

Without a solid data quality in Dynamics 365 strategy, you risk:

  • Duplicate records: Multiple entries for the same customer.
  • Inconsistent formats: Different date or currency formats across departments.
  • Outdated information: Old email addresses or expired product details.
  • Reporting inaccuracies: Misleading insights that hurt decision-making.

According to Gartner, poor data quality costs businesses over $12 million annually—and these losses can often be traced back to integration issues.

Best Practices for Microsoft Dynamics 365 Data Integration

Let’s explore the most effective strategies for clean, consistent data in your Dynamics 365 environment.

1. Define Your Data Governance Policy

Before starting any integration, define clear rules for data entry, updates, and validation. This ensures that all incoming data—whether from marketing automation tools, ERP platforms, or third-party apps—meets your organization’s standards.

Pro Tip: Use master data management in Dynamics 365 to centralize your most important business entities (e.g., customer profiles, product catalogs, supplier details).

2. Choose the Right Integration Method

There are multiple ways to integrate data with Dynamics 365:

  • Native connectors (e.g., Power Automate, Dataverse) for Microsoft ecosystem tools.
  • Custom APIs for specialized integration needs.
  • Third-party iPaaS platforms like KingswaySoft, Scribe, or Azure Data Factory.

Selecting the right method depends on your data volume, complexity, and frequency of updates.

3. Maintain Data Quality at Every Step

To maintain clean data in Dynamics 365, implement automated validation rules during integration. This includes:

  • Duplicate detection to prevent multiple entries.
  • Format standardization for phone numbers, emails, and addresses.
  • Real-time error logging so issues are fixed immediately.

4. Map and Transform Data Carefully

When migrating or integrating, ensure that fields from the source system align perfectly with their destination fields in Dynamics 365. Incorrect mapping can result in misplaced or missing information.

Example:

  • ERP “Customer ID” → CRM “Account Number”
  • ERP “Invoice Date” → CRM “Transaction Date”

5. Integrate for Both ERP and CRM

One of the biggest advantages of Microsoft’s ecosystem is the seamless Dynamics 365 CRM and ERP integration. This allows sales, finance, and operations teams to work with consistent data in Dynamics 365 without manual transfers.

6. Schedule Regular Data Audits

Even with automation, no system is perfect. Conduct quarterly or monthly data audits to identify and fix:

  • Missing fields
  • Invalid entries
  • Outdated records

These audits are key to master data management in Dynamics 365.

7. Use Incremental Sync Instead of Full Imports

Rather than importing your entire dataset every time, use incremental synchronization—only update records that have changed since the last sync. This saves time and reduces the risk of overwriting correct data.

8. Test Before Going Live

Run your integration in a sandbox environment to:

  • Verify field mappings.
  • Test automation rules.
  • Validate data quality in Dynamics 365.

Key Tools for Dynamics 365 Data Integration

Tool / MethodBest ForProsCons
Power AutomateMicrosoft appsEasy to useLimited for large datasets
Azure Data FactoryComplex pipelinesHighly scalableRequires technical expertise
KingswaySoftOn-prem & cloud appsFlexibleLicensing cost
Scribe InsightLegacy systemsGood mapping toolsLearning curve

Maintaining Consistent Data in Dynamics 365 Post-Integration

Once the initial integration is complete, the real challenge is maintaining data consistency. Follow these steps:

  1. Automate updates from connected systems.
  2. Train teams on correct data entry.
  3. Monitor KPIs like duplicate rate, error rate, and data completeness.

The Role of Data Migration in Dynamics 365

When moving from legacy systems, Dynamics 365 data migration is a critical step. Migrations must be:

  • Planned with clear timelines and backup strategies.
  • Validated with sample data before full execution.
  • Monitored for accuracy after completion.

Conclusion: Unlocking the Power of Clean Data

Clean, consistent, and integrated data is the backbone of any digital-first business. By following the best practices outlined here—covering governance, quality control, mapping, and ongoing audits—you can maximize the value of Dynamics 365 data integration.

Whether you’re merging ERP and CRM, connecting marketing platforms, or unifying legacy systems, investing in integration today sets you up for faster decisions, better customer experiences, and long-term scalability.

If you’re ready to implement or optimize your Microsoft Dynamics 365 data integration strategy, contact Dynamics Square UK today. Our team of experts can help you achieve clean, consistent, and actionable data that drives results.